My sister got 340 marks in NEET WE BELONG TO SC CATEGORY, HER ALL INDIA RANK IS 2619240 & SC CATEGORY RANK IS 23045, Can she get admission in MBBS OR BMAS IN MAHARSHTRA GOVERNMENT COLLEGE

Hello Vikas,
According to previous year data and considering the raise in cut off this year ,with all india rank of around 2.6 lakhs, your sister cannot get a MBBS seat in conveyor quota but you can try for management quota or in central/deemed universities if you can afford.

But your sister have chances to get a BAMS seat mostly private colleges under conveyor quota.
